From: Mathieu Malaterre Date: Thu, 27 Feb 2014 08:38:55 +0000 (+0000) Subject: [trunk] simplify code using for loop X-Git-Tag: version.2.0.1~4^2~190 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=a7cc5b6a5d793746772a3bb2e9e12f5e08ad9bc3;p=openjpeg [trunk] simplify code using for loop --- diff --git a/tests/unit/CMakeLists.txt b/tests/unit/CMakeLists.txt index a22d00a1..ae47b88e 100644 --- a/tests/unit/CMakeLists.txt +++ b/tests/unit/CMakeLists.txt @@ -5,14 +5,13 @@ include_directories( ${OPENJPEG_SOURCE_DIR}/src/lib/openjp2 ) -add_executable(testempty0 testempty0.c) -add_executable(testempty1 testempty1.c) -add_executable(testempty2 testempty2.c) - -target_link_libraries(testempty0 openjp2) -target_link_libraries(testempty1 openjp2) -target_link_libraries(testempty2 openjp2) - -add_test(NAME testempty0 COMMAND testempty0) -add_test(NAME testempty1 COMMAND testempty1) -add_test(NAME testempty2 COMMAND testempty2) +set(unit_test + testempty0 + testempty1 + testempty2 +) +foreach(ut ${unit_test}) + add_executable(${ut} ${ut}.c) + target_link_libraries(${ut} openjp2) + add_test(NAME ${ut} COMMAND ${ut}) +endforeach()